Winter at Es Trenc Beach, Mallorca, Spain is one of the most breathtaking travel experiences in Europe, where crystal-clear turquoise sea meets endless white sand and wide open horizons. During the winter season, the beach becomes quiet and almost empty, creating a peaceful escape that feels far away from mass tourism and perfect for slow travel, nature lovers, and photography fans. The Mediterranean light is softer, the colors of the sea feel deeper, and the surrounding landscape shows a raw, natural beauty that’s ideal for a relaxing holiday mood.

Visiting Mallorca in the off season means fewer crowds, cooler temperatures for long beach walks, easier access, and a more authentic connection with local life. Around Es Trenc, places like Ses Salines and Colònia de Sant Jordi offer charming cafés, scenic coastal paths, and stunning viewpoints without the summer rush. The nearby salt flats and dunes add to the unique scenery, making this area one of the most iconic coastal landscapes in Spain and a hidden winter gem in Europe.

If you’re dreaming of a Mallorca holiday, a Spain travel escape, or a calm European beach destination, Es Trenc in winter delivers serenity, natural beauty, and unforgettable sea views.


🏝️Good to know: Es Trenc is famous for its Caribbean-like water color, caused by its fine white sand and shallow seabed.

In winter, Playa de Alcúdia on Mallorca, Spain, turns into a breathtaking Mediterranean escape where the turquoise sea, wide sandy beach, and open horizon create pure travel inspiration and deep emotional calm. The empty beach, fresh sea air, and soft winter light make this one of the most relaxing holiday destinations in Europe, perfect for slow travel, beach walks, mindfulness, and stunning travel photography without crowds or noise. Visiting Mallorca in the off season means mild winter weather, fewer tourists, better hotel prices, and a more authentic island experience, ideal for tourists, holiday guests, and locals who want to discover the true beauty of Spain beyond summer. Around the corner, the historic Alcúdia Old Town offers ancient city walls and charming streets, while Albufera Natural Park adds untouched landscapes, wildlife, and peaceful nature moments loved by travel lovers worldwide. From here, a scenic drive leads to Cap de Formentor, one of the most famous viewpoints in Europe, known for dramatic cliffs, panoramic sea views, and iconic Mallorca travel shots seen all over social media.

Hop on the legendary Train de Sóller in Mallorca, Spain and instantly become part of one of the most iconic travel experiences in Europe. This vintage wooden train has been carrying visitors and locals through the Serra de Tramuntana mountains since 1912, creating postcard-perfect moments as it winds past olive groves, orange orchards, dramatic cliffs, and sun-drenched valleys that beg to be captured for your feed. It’s easily one of the top things to do on your Mallorca holiday and a must-see on every Spain travel bucket list.

Arriving in the charming town of Sóller, you’ll find a vibrant plaza, beautiful modernist architecture, cozy cafés and tapas bars, and markets filled with fresh local flavours — perfect for immersive cultural content and unforgettable holiday memories. From there, hop on the classic wooden tram down to Port de Sóller, where a stunning coastal promenade, crystal blue sea, and relaxed beach vibes await. Snap sunrise and sunset shots on the beach, explore hidden coves, and capture views from popular scenic spots like Mirador de Ses Barques and the fairytale village of Fornalutx, consistently trending on travel feeds worldwide.
